NASA guided Atlantis to a rare Florida landing today after high wind and damp runways prevented the space shuttle and its five astronauts from touching down in the California desert.

There have been six space shuttle landings in Florida, most recently in 1985, when Discovery blew a tire.

Atlantis, which began its secret mission Thursday with an unusual nighttime liftoff, landed at Kennedy Space Center after circling the world 80 times.

Atlantis was supposed to land Monday at Edwards Air Force Base, Calif.
